The Haifa Language and Liberal Arts Program offers a semester, or year, in the vibrant and cosmopolitan Mediterranean port of Haifa, Israel. The program combines language study with other coursework at the University of Haifa and excursions in Israel. There is also an opportunity for students to participate in an internship while studying in Haifa. Upon successful completion of the program, students earn between 16 and 20 Boston University credits. Download a program one-sheet.

The International School of the University of Haifa offers a wide range of courses (taught in English). The International School designed all its courses for full-time, undergraduate students, and awards academic credit in accord with the standards and criteria of North American and European universities.

Internship Option
A student may participate in an internship, under the supervision of the International School and an on-site supervisor, for up to four Boston University credits.

Placements vary according to students’ interests, backgrounds, and language abilities. Internships have been offered in such fields as medical services, archaeology, education, public relations, social work, conflict resolution, and women’s studies.

Pre-Semester Options
So that students can get the most out of their time in Israel, Boston University and the University of Haifa can often offer students opportunities to live in Israel and gain credit before the regular semester begins at no additional cost. These opportunities vary from semester to semester, but may include a study tour, intensive Arabic language program, or an Ulpan (intensive Hebrew language program).
